The Cure own Robert Smith is 48...London Concert Review

The Cure own Robert Smith is closing on 50 (48 to be exact) and still putting on a good show if you like his blend of gloom and pop tunes.
In a review of  their recent Wembley Arena (London) Show, Ludovic Hunter-Tilney (FT) gives them credit while describing Robert's hair as 'trademark Edward Scissorhands tangle'.
Hard to believe but as Ludovic reminds us The Cure first single 'Killing an Arab' (inspired by L'etranger by Albert Camus) came out some 30 years ago.

There were concerns on the song being mistaken as racist as Rock Group Accedes to Arab Protest by Jon Pareles (NY Times, January 2007) showed.
